Subject: DR drill Thursday — tracing stack

Plugin authors: Thursday we fail over the Wrenfall tracing collector to the standby region. Expect span gaps of up to five minutes. Your plugins must buffer, not drop. Post-drill, re-register exporters against the standby endpoint listed in the drill doc. Registration requires unlocking the plugin credential store, which will be sealed during failover. Unseal it with the recovery passphrase provided below.

strongbox words: tamath-ulaiel-istion-kasok-briwyn-pelath-gorir-praeth-silys-fenmir

# Env file — Cartwheel dispatch, driver-assignment heuristic
# Scope: staging only. Do not promote to prod.
# The heuristic weights (proximity, shift balance, refusal rate) are tuned
# for the Velmont pilot region and will misbehave elsewhere.
# Review notes: heuristic service runs unprivileged; it reads weights
# read-only from the tuning store and writes nothing back.
# Only one sensitive value exists in this file: the tuning-store access
# credential, consumed at boot and never logged.
# That credential is set on the following line.

secret setting of faduf-bahop: LEDGER_TOKEN8=c3b363be

CI note for the reviewer: the Garagemeter occupancy feed tests keep flaking on the staging runner because the mock gate sensors emit timestamps in local time, not UTC. Nothing nefarious — no credentials are involved, the feed is read-only. We pinned the runner's timezone and the suite went green. The run you'll want to audit is tagged with the token right below.

pipeline stamp: htk9_ce63042d9